The Evolution of EMS Training Electrical Muscle Stimulation (EMS) first appeared in clinical rehabilitation, using pulsed currents to prevent muscle atrophy in immobile patients. Over the past decade, fitness studios adopted whole-body EMS suits, repurposing the technology for strength, endurance, and fat-loss programs. Early devices offered fixed stimulation protocols; today’s systems harness algorithms and sensors to adapt in real time. What began as passive therapy has become an active, data-driven discipline—setting the stage for AI-powered personalization.
